Tropical Pineapple Moonshine

Kiss the dog days goodbye with this Tropical Pineapple Moonshine that immediately whisks you away to a white sand beach with your toes in the sand.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es
Servings 4 8-ounce mason jars

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up pineapple juice
  • 2 vanilla pods, sliced down the center
  • 1 8-ounce can coconut water
  • 2 cups white sugar
  • 1 pineapple (Can use 46-ounce can of pineapple chunks)
  • 750 ML Everclear or plain moonshine

Tropical Pineapple Cocktail

  • 4 oz Tropical Pineapple Moonshine
  • 4 oz club soda
  • Splash of lemon juice
  • Crushed ice

Instructions
 

Pineapple Simple Syrup

  • Combine pineapple juice, vanilla pods, coconut water, and sugar in a saucepan over medium heat.
  • Stir until the sugar dissolves, and b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for 5 minutes.
  • Remove the vanilla pods. Set aside and cool syrup.

Tropical Pineapple Moonshine

  • Break down pineapple and slice into cubes if you're using a whole pineapple. Add cubes to a large bowl and mash with the back of wooden spoon. If you have muddling tools, you can use those to get the job done.
  • Add moonshine and Pineapple Simple Syrup to the bowl. Stir to combine.
  • Portion into 8-ounce mason jars. Split pods into equal segments so each jar has a vanilla pod inside.
  • Store in a cool, dark place. If your pantry is out of direct sunlight, that's the perfect place for this infusion.

Tropical Pineapple Cocktail

  • Combine Tropical Pineapple Moonshine and club soda in a glass. Add a splash of lemon juice and crushed ice, and stir to combine. Garnish with a slice of pineapple if you like, and enjoy your trip to the tropics!

Notes

As we always say, the longer a moonshine infusion sits, the better it gets. This infusion will store up to a year in a cool, dark place, but please imbibe responsibly.
